ceph怎么保证高可用?

小蕊 发表于: 2023-02-27   最后更新时间: 2023-02-27 11:29:27   862 游览

如题。

发表于 2023-02-27
添加评论

Ceph是一个开源的分布式存储系统,提供了高可用性和可扩展性,能够管理PB级别的数据。下面是一些保持Ceph高可用的常见方法:

1.使用多副本池
Ceph支持多副本池,这意味着数据会被存储在多个节点上,即使某个节点故障,数据仍然可以从其他副本中恢复。使用多副本池可以提高数据的可用性。

2.使用故障域
Ceph支持故障域,它将不同的节点分组,例如不同的机架、不同的机房等。通过使用故障域,可以确保即使整个节点组发生故障,数据也可以从其他节点组中恢复。

3.使用自动化的数据恢复
Ceph有一个自动化的数据恢复机制,可以自动将数据从故障的节点复制到其他节点,从而保持数据的可用性。这个机制可以大大减少数据恢复的时间和人工干预的需求。

4.监控和报警
Ceph提供了丰富的监控和报警功能,可以实时监测存储集群的状态和性能。通过监测和报警,可以及时发现和处理故障,从而保持系统的高可用性。

5.定期备份
虽然Ceph是一个高可用的存储系统,但是定期备份仍然是保证数据安全和可用性的一个好习惯。定期备份可以防止数据丢失或损坏,同时可以在需要时快速恢复数据。

总的来说,保持Ceph高可用需要综合使用多种方法,包括数据备份、故障域、多副本池、自动化的数据恢复和监控报警等,才能确保系统的高可用性和数据的安全性。

你的答案

查看ceph相关的其他问题或提一个您自己的问题